Medical Malpractice

Medical malpractice claims can be filed at any time during the pregnancy, labor, or birth process. Medical malpractice claims can be filed if a physician is not practicing the accepted standard of practice and the failure causes birth defects or injury.

Doctors are responsible for evaluating the mother's current medications and taking into consideration any health issues she may have, and advising the woman of potential dangers to her unborn child. A doctor who fails to perform their duties and causes harm could be held accountable for medical negligence.

Environmental Causes

Although birth defects resulting from genetic causes make up a large portion of all cases, environmental causes can also have a hand in. These factors are not always discovered by science but could be the mother's exposure at home or work to harmful chemicals. These chemicals, such as solvents paint thinners, solvents processing fluids, cleaning fluids and certain alloys of iron, can increase the risk of children developing birth defects. Drugs

Pregnancy-related medications can lead to birth defects. These include limb and face abnormalities or eye problems, brain and spinal cord problems, among other things. If an medication causes birth defects, the family could take action against the drug manufacturer in a product liability suit.

Birth defects can also be caused through exposure to prescription drugs or toxic chemicals, as well as other environmental factors in the first three months of pregnancy, which is a crucial time for development.
